nieuws: ignore non-numeric month requests
[minimedit.git] / nieuws / index.php
index 05c995af1a38b1f8b8646bd78f774848c22a335a..25efd2daf017882e6e3b49ac55c623e755457f5f 100644 (file)
@@ -11,14 +11,18 @@ if ($page and !is_numeric($page)) {
 
 if ($year) {
        ob_clean();
+       $title = "Nieuws";
        if (is_numeric($year)) {
-               $title = "Nieuws ".($page ? $monthname[$page].' ' : '').$year;
                $match = "$Page/$year/";
-               if ($page) $match .= sprintf('%02d-', $page);
+               if (is_numeric($page)) {
+                       $title .= ' '.$monthname[intval($page)];
+                       $match .= sprintf('%02d-', $page);
+               }
+               $title .= ' '.$year;
        }
        else {
-               $title = "Nieuws vóór 2000";
                $match = "$Page/19??/";
+               $title .= " vóór 2000";
        }
 
        print "<h2>$title</h2>\n\n";